Project Euler 638 题解

news/2024/10/15 21:22:18

q-analog,老玩家集体起立!

image

这也就是说:

\[\binom{n+m}{n}_q=\sum_{\pi\in L_{n,m}}q^{area(\pi)} \]

结束!

#include<bits/stdc++.h>
using namespace std;
#define int long long
const int mod=1e9+7,maxn=2e7+5;
int qp(int a,int b,int p=mod){int res=1;while(b){if(b&1)res=(res*a)%p;a=(a*a)%p;b>>=1;}return res;
}
int fac[maxn];
int C(int n,int m,int q){fac[1]=1;int I=qp(q-1,mod-2);for(int i=2,z=q;i<=n;i++){z=z*q%mod;int x=(z-1)*I%mod;if(q==1)x=i;fac[i]=fac[i-1]*x%mod;}return fac[n]*qp(fac[m],mod-2,mod)%mod*qp(fac[n-m],mod-2,mod)%mod;
}
signed main(){ios::sync_with_stdio(false);cin.tie(0);cout.tie(0);int K,ans=0;cin>>K;for(int i=1;i<=K;i++)(ans+=C((pow(10,i)+i)*2,pow(10,i)+i,i))%=mod;cout<<ans<<endl;return 0;
}

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.ryyt.cn/news/71990.html

如若内容造成侵权/违法违规/事实不符,请联系我们进行投诉反馈,一经查实,立即删除!

相关文章

【bypass】bash绕过waf 的小技巧

原创 良辰 红队笔记录无意中看到推特上面有个老外分享的一条命令 $0<<<$\\\$(($((1<<1))#10011010))\\$(($((1<<1))#10100011))\其实这个命令就是ls 搜了一下原来是这个意思 $((1<<1)) 将 1 左移 1 位,得到 2。 2#10011010 将二进制数 10011010 转…

Windows刷机-记录UltraSO工具安装错误

安装镜像刻录U盘工具UltralSO:UltraISO - ISO CD/DVD image creator, editor, burner, converter and virtual CD/DVD emulator - UltraISO download page 下载后使用注册码激活: UltralSO多国语言版注册码 用户名:Steve Olson 注册码:2BEC-ED28-82BB-95D7 UltralSO简体中文版…

ElasticSearch的倒排索引和相关概念与MySQL的对比

ElasticSearch的倒排索引和相关概念 在用关系型数据库时,一些频繁用作查询条件的字段我们都会去建立索引来提升查询效率。在关系型数据库中,我们一般都采用 B 树索引进行存储,所以 B 树索引也是我们接触比较多的一种索引数据结构,但是在使用过程中,我们发现无法使用关系型…

VS新建文件时在头部附加版权信息

用记事本打开“C:\Program Files (x86)\Microsoft Visual Studio\2017\Community\Common7\IDE\ItemTemplates\CSharp\Code\2052\Class\Class.cs”文件 //---------------------------------------------------------------- // Copyright (C) 2017 xx公司 // 文件名:$safeitem…

SaaS架构:应用服务、应用结构设计

大家好,我是汤师爷~ 应用架构设计通常包括以下步骤:根据业务架构,将业务需求转化为IT系统,识别核心应用服务。 划分应用结构,设计应用结构与业务流程、数据之间的关系。 设计应用结构之间的交互和集成关系。本文主要分享一下应用服务、应用结构设计设计。 应用服务设计 应…

ES相关

ES是一款强大的开源搜索引擎,其主要的实现是通过倒排索引; 关于倒排索引: 首先有倒排索引,那就有正排的 比如经典的mysql 就是正排 其使用索引来加快查询的速度 在一个基本的表结构中有一个主键自增的索引来表示;但是在某些情况下索引会失效;这个时候尤其是大量的数据的查…

基于FPGA的16PSK调制解调系统,包含testbench,高斯信道模块,误码率统计模块,可以设置不同SNR

1.算法仿真效果 VIVADO2019.2仿真结果如下(完整代码运行后无水印):设置SNR=30db设置SNR=20db:系统RTL结构图如下:2.算法涉及理论知识概要十六进制相位移键控(16PSK, 16-Phase Shift Keying)是一种数字调制技术,它通过改变载波相位来传输信息。16PSK能够在一个符号时间内…

倒排索引和ES相关概念对比MySQL

1.倒排索引 1.1倒排索引两个重要概念:文档:用来搜索的数据,其中的每一条数据就是一个文档。例如一个网页、一个商品信息以京东商城为列词条(Term):对文档数据或用户搜索数据,利用某种算法分词,得到的具备含义的词语就是词条。例如:我是中国人,就可以分为:我、是、中…